Output 24e7dde81cc591db7eb9daaebaf670e400bcf884143f2b491e738edbb18e959d:0

value
16925621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95ea971ef493f2e15f8f0a6fc26559019885ee7 OP_EQUAL
address
3NxxmTs8nUBXeBJqmKx1E5PM54YAyFsAk2
transaction
24e7dde81cc591db7eb9daaebaf670e400bcf884143f2b491e738edbb18e959d
spent
true